WebDec 21, 2024 · To start cleaning out the main drain clog, find your home’s sewer line cleanout location. Typically, the sewer cleanout location is a small t-shaped section of pipe with a cap that’s a few inches off the ground. Once you find it, use a pipe wrench to loosen the cap a bit at a time. WebAug 28, 2024 · Trace the plumbing drain lines to the septic tank, which is usually installed 10 to 20 feet from the home's exterior. At the tank's end opposite the house, the drain line leads to the leach field. Check the natural slope of the land to locate the leach field. When searching for drain lines, never use heavy machinery, wrecking bars or jackhammers.
